Policy Conflict Detection

Policy conflict detection is the process of identifying contradictory or overlapping rules within an organization's security policies. These conflicts can arise from different systems, departments, or regulatory requirements. Detecting them helps prevent vulnerabilities, ensure compliance, and maintain consistent security posture. It is crucial for effective governance and operational efficiency in complex IT environments.

Understanding Policy Conflict Detection

Organizations use automated tools and manual reviews for policy conflict detection. For instance, a firewall rule allowing all outbound traffic might conflict with a data loss prevention policy restricting sensitive data transfers. Similarly, an access control policy granting broad permissions could clash with a least privilege principle. Tools analyze policy sets across various security controls like firewalls, identity and access management systems, and cloud configurations. This proactive approach helps security teams identify and resolve inconsistencies before they lead to security gaps, unauthorized access, or compliance failures. It ensures that all security measures work together effectively.

Responsibility for policy conflict detection typically falls to security operations teams, compliance officers, and IT governance committees. Effective detection is vital for maintaining a strong security posture and adhering to regulatory mandates. Unresolved conflicts can lead to significant risks, including data breaches, operational disruptions, and non-compliance penalties. Strategically, it supports a unified security framework, reduces attack surfaces, and improves overall resilience. This process is fundamental to robust cybersecurity governance and risk management.

How Policy Conflict Detection Processes Identity, Context, and Access Decisions

Policy conflict detection involves systematically analyzing security policies to find rules that contradict or overlap. This process identifies situations where two or more policies apply to the same resource or action but prescribe different or opposing outcomes. Tools often use logic engines or rule-based systems to compare policy statements, conditions, and actions. For example, one policy might allow network access for a user group, while another denies it based on a different attribute. The detection mechanism highlights these discrepancies, preventing unintended security gaps or over-permissive access. It ensures policies function as intended before deployment.

Policy conflict detection is an ongoing process, not a one-time event. It integrates into the security policy lifecycle, from initial design and testing to regular audits and updates. Governance involves defining clear procedures for resolving identified conflicts, often requiring collaboration between security, network, and compliance teams. This mechanism works with other security tools like SIEM systems, identity and access management IAM, and firewall management platforms to maintain a consistent and effective security posture across the environment. Regular reviews are crucial to adapt to changing threats and business needs.

Places Policy Conflict Detection Is Commonly Used

Policy conflict detection is essential for maintaining a robust security posture across various IT environments.

  • Ensuring firewall rules do not create unintended open ports or block legitimate traffic.
  • Validating access control lists ACLs to prevent contradictory permissions on shared resources.
  • Reviewing cloud security policies to avoid conflicting configurations in IaaS or PaaS.
  • Auditing identity and access management IAM policies for users with excessive or conflicting roles.
  • Detecting overlaps in data loss prevention DLP rules that might cause data exfiltration or false positives.

The Biggest Takeaways of Policy Conflict Detection

  • Implement automated tools for continuous policy conflict detection to catch issues early.
  • Establish a clear process for reviewing and resolving identified policy conflicts promptly.
  • Regularly audit all security policies, including network, cloud, and access controls, for consistency.
  • Integrate conflict detection into your change management process for new policy deployments.

What We Often Get Wrong

Conflict detection is only for firewalls.

While crucial for firewalls, policy conflict detection applies broadly. It is vital for cloud security groups, identity and access management IAM policies, network access control NAC, and data loss prevention DLP rules. Limiting its scope leaves significant security gaps.

Manual review is sufficient.

Manual review of policies is prone to human error and becomes impractical with scale. Complex environments with hundreds or thousands of rules require automated tools to efficiently identify subtle conflicts and ensure comprehensive coverage. Relying solely on manual checks is risky.

All conflicts are critical.

Not every detected conflict poses an immediate critical threat. Some might be minor overlaps or intended overrides. Prioritization is key. Focus on conflicts that could lead to unauthorized access, data breaches, or significant operational disruption first.

On this page

Frequently Asked Questions

What is policy conflict detection?

Policy conflict detection is the process of identifying contradictory or overlapping rules within an organization's security policies. These conflicts can arise from different systems, departments, or regulatory requirements. The goal is to ensure that all policies work together harmoniously, preventing unintended security gaps or access issues. It helps maintain a consistent and effective security posture across the entire IT environment.

Why is policy conflict detection important?

Detecting policy conflicts is crucial for maintaining strong security and operational efficiency. Undetected conflicts can lead to unauthorized access, compliance violations, and system vulnerabilities. They can also cause operational delays and errors when different rules clash. Proactive detection helps organizations enforce consistent security controls, reduce risk, and ensure that their security framework functions as intended without unintended loopholes.

How are policy conflicts typically detected?

Policy conflicts are often detected through automated tools that analyze security policies across various systems, such as firewalls, identity and access management (IAM) systems, and cloud configurations. These tools can simulate policy interactions and highlight inconsistencies or redundancies. Manual reviews and audits also play a role, especially for complex or newly implemented policies, to ensure alignment with organizational goals and regulatory mandates.

What are the consequences of undetected policy conflicts?

Undetected policy conflicts can have severe consequences. They may create security vulnerabilities, allowing unauthorized users to bypass controls or gain elevated privileges. This increases the risk of data breaches and cyberattacks. Furthermore, conflicts can lead to non-compliance with industry regulations, resulting in hefty fines and reputational damage. Operationally, they cause system errors, access denials for legitimate users, and increased administrative overhead.